Position Overview
Under the supervision of a Pathologist or Managing Pathologists’ Assistant, you’ll perform accessioning, preparation, and dissection of human surgical and postmortem specimens. You’ll also provide essential technical and logistical support to pathologists, residents, and laboratory teams—ensuring smooth daily operations, accuracy, and compliance with all regulatory standards.
Key Responsibilities
-
Perform gross examination, description, and dissection of surgical pathology specimens, including complex resections.
-
Assist in frozen section preparation, tissue processing, and gross photography.
-
Support autopsy services, including external and internal examination, organ dissection, and specimen collection.
-
Maintain the cleanliness, organization, and infection control of surgical pathology and autopsy suites.
-
Manage laboratory inventory, equipment maintenance, and quality control documentation.
-
Collaborate with the Decedent Affairs Office to ensure accurate documentation and respectful handling of deceased patients.
-
Participate in staff training and mentoring for grossing technicians and Pathologists’ Assistant students.
Qualifications
-
Graduate of an accredited Pathologists’ Assistant program.
-
PA (ASCP) certification required (or eligibility within 6 months of hire).
-
1–2 years of experience preferred; new graduates are encouraged to apply.
-
Strong understanding of human anatomy, pathology grossing techniques, and laboratory safety.
-
Excellent communication, organization, and attention to detail.
-
Experience with EMR and LIS systems preferred.
